Brussels: Europe and the Arabs
The European Union welcomed the agreement to release 50 hostages from Gaza for a long-term cessation of the conflict. According to what Josep Borrell, the EU’s foreign policy coordinator, previously wrote on the X " twitter" website, he added, “After 7 weeks of suffering, they will finally be reunited with their families. We demand "Immediately release all hostages."
A statement was issued in Brussels by the President of the European Commission, Ursula Fon-Derlein, which said: “I warmly welcome the agreement reached on the release of the 50 hostages and the cessation of hostilities. Every day that these mothers and children are held hostage by terrorists is one day too many. I share The joy of families who will soon be able to embrace their loved ones again. I am deeply grateful to all those who have worked tirelessly through diplomatic channels in recent weeks to broker this agreement. I call on the terrorist group Hamas to immediately release all hostages and allow them to return home safely.
The European Commission will do its utmost to take advantage of this pause in order to increase humanitarian aid to Gaza. I have asked Commissioner Janez Lenarčić to increase additional shipments to Gaza as soon as possible to alleviate the humanitarian crisis in Gaza.
